Limit Search Results
Author
Language
Format
Subject
Switch to list view
Switch to thumbnail view
390 Results Found Subscribe to search results
000000000000MAIN
Print
1. 
Cover image for Advanced renewable energy sources
2. 
Cover image for Renewable energy sources and emerging technologies
4. 
Cover image for Renewable energy sources : international progress
10. 
Cover image for Renewable energy sources and climate change mitigation : special report of the Intergovernmental Panel on Climate Change
11. 
Cover image for Electrochemical energy storage for renewable sources and grid balancing
Go to:Search Results
|
Top of Page
|
Search Facets